About the role
About the role
Join MacKillop Family Services as a Youth Residential Care Worker and support young people in a safe, therapeutic home environment. You’ll help with daily routines, build meaningful relationships, and respond to complex needs with empathy and professionalism. Every shift is different, and you’ll be part of a team committed to child safety, healing, and growth. MacKillop provides training, supervision, and opportunities to develop your career while making a real impact.
If you’re ready to be part of something meaningful, we’d love to hear from you.
This is a casual opportunity based in the west metro region within our OOHC program. The position reports to the Residential House Supervisor.

Our Commitment:
MacKillop celebrates and draws strength from diversity and respects the dignity of all people. Every person at MacKillop has the right to be safe and to be treated justly. We value every person’s ability, cultural or linguistic backgrounds, ethnicity, sexual orientation, gender identity, gender expression, intersex status, relationship status, religious or spiritual beliefs, socio-economic status, and age.
It is our goal that MacKillop Family Services continues to evolve as a culturally safe, culturally competent, and welcoming organisation to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ander children, young people, families, and communities.
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people are strongly encouraged to apply for this position.
